How are Naan and White cake different?

  • Naan has more Manganese, Phosphorus, Vitamin B3, Fiber, Magnesium, Copper, Zinc, Vitamin E , and Vitamin B6 than White cake.
  • Daily need coverage for Manganese from Naan is 49% higher.
  • Naan contains 11 times more Vitamin E than White cake. While Naan contains 1.32mg of Vitamin E , White cake contains only 0.12mg.
  • White cake has less Sodium.

Bread, naan, whole wheat, commercially prepared, refrigerated and Cake, white, prepared from recipe with coconut frosting are the varieties used in this article.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Naan White cake Opinion
Net carbs 41.41g 62.2g White cake
Protein 10.2g 4.4g Naan
Fats 6.7g 10.3g White cake
Carbs 46.21g 63.2g White cake
Calories 286kcal 356kcal White cake
Starch 36g Naan
Fructose 0.8g Naan
Sugar 3.4g 57.39g Naan
Fiber 4.8g 1g Naan
Calcium 59mg 90mg White cake
Iron 1.73mg 1.16mg Naan
Magnesium 68mg 12mg Naan
Phosphorus 188mg 70mg Naan
Potassium 185mg 99mg Naan
Sodium 467mg 284mg White cake
Zinc 1.24mg 0.33mg Naan
Copper 0.158mg 0.067mg Naan
Manganese 1.4mg 0.277mg Naan
Selenium 11.4µg 10.7µg Naan
Vitamin A 6IU 42IU White cake
Vitamin A RAE 2µg 12µg White cake
Vitamin E 1.32mg 0.12mg Naan
Vitamin D 0IU 8IU White cake
Vitamin D 0µg 0.2µg White cake
Vitamin C 0mg 0.1mg White cake
Vitamin B1 0.176mg 0.128mg Naan
Vitamin B2 0.18mg 0.189mg White cake
Vitamin B3 3.58mg 1.063mg Naan
Vitamin B5 0.167mg White cake
Vitamin B6 0.128mg 0.029mg Naan
Folate 16µg 31µg White cake
Vitamin B12 0µg 0.06µg White cake
Vitamin K 3.3µg 4.1µg White cake
Tryptophan 0.054mg White cake
Threonine 0.157mg White cake
Isoleucine 0.199mg White cake
Leucine 0.338mg White cake
Lysine 0.204mg White cake
Methionine 0.107mg White cake
Phenylalanine 0.228mg White cake
Valine 0.229mg White cake
Histidine 0.099mg White cake
Cholesterol 1mg 1mg
Saturated Fat 2.907g 3.897g Naan
Monounsaturated Fat 1.946g 3.692g White cake
Polyunsaturated fat 1.258g 2.162g White cake
